  • Sound only coming from left speaker.

    I recorded live music last night from a soundboard in a music hall. The new belkin tunetalk pro on my ipod g5 worked really well and was easy to use. Problem is I did not have the right kinda hookups. I need two 1/4 plugs that converted to one 1/8 mini jack. so i had one 1/4 to 1/8 mini and they gave me a great sounding feed but it's only on the left as in the left ear. i downloaded to to itunes. actually it did it as soon as i pluged the ipod in. i did nothing. the sound guys said i should be able to split to right and left with something like garageband software. i impoted into GB and now i still have the great sound coming out of my left speaker and nothing on the right unless i choose mono 1 or mono 2.
    my question is how do i split this and make the recording come out of both speakers? the file in garageband has 2 wave zigzag lines. one on top of the other. i'm sure there's a way but so far i've not found an easy fix on apple garageband support groups but i've not asked either. tonight i will have the right connections so will see how well a rock show records. last nights was an acoustic show with a guitar and vocal mic

    You can't really make a stereo file from a mono recording.
    Stereo needs two mic/2 channels in the recording phase. The best you can do is set the track to mono so it comes from both speakers, or create fake stereo by using two tracks and offsetting one of them slightly and panning each track to the side some. It won't be stereo, there will be no center, just Left and right

  • Zoom H4n Stereo Audio Plays Only Left Speaker - How to Double It?

    Hello Everyone,
    I've been working on a few projects and noticed that the audio captured by the Zoom H4n will preview in both speakers (and before I drag it to the timeline I can right click -> Modify ->Audio Channels and get all the options there as well as hear it from both speakers) but as soon as I drag it onto the timeline it will only play through the left speaker.
    Any ideas of either where I'm going wrong or how I can double the audio? It's all already cut together so I'm hoping there's a fix that is semi-time efficient to apply lol. Thanks so much for your help,
    -Karl

    Glad that helped! Next time, you can use the Modify > Audio Channels command to handle this before editing. If you only have audio on the left channel of your stereo source clip, or don't care about what's on the right, you could set the stereo audio to be treated as dual mono. When you put the mono source tracks into a sequence with a stereo master track, the mono source will automatically be routed to both stereo output channels. You can then use the Pan knobs in the Audio Mixer to position each sequence track in the stereo spread. This has to be done before you use the source clip in a sequence, however.
